For Android devices, try clearing stored Bose app data from the device. If using an Android device, you can clear the app data that the device stores for the Bose app. To do this, go to the device Settings menu and look for the Apps menu. Select the Bose app and choose both Clear Cache and Clear Data.
Why are my Bose headphones not connecting to Bluetooth?
Go to the Bluetooth® menu in the device settings and remove your Bose product. Then, try connecting again. In the Bluetooth settings of the device, you should see a list of Bluetooth devices that have previously connected to the device. Locate your Bose product in the list and remove it.

How do I clear my Bose speaker pairing list?
To clear the product memory of connected Bluetooth® devices using just the remote:
- On the Bose remote, press the SOURCE button.
- Use the up or down buttons of the navigation pad to highlight the Bluetooth source then press OK.
- Press the More button.
- Press the down arrow once to highlight Clear Pairing List.
- Press OK.

Is there a Bluetooth button on a Bose headphone?
Most Bose speakers will have a dedicated Bluetooth button. To make these devices discoverable, press and hold this button for three seconds or until the Bluetooth indicator light flashes blue. For some devices, you simply need to press this button once to make it discoverable. However, many of the Bose headphones do not have a Bluetooth button.

How do you clear Bluetooth on a Bose speaker?
Press and hold the ‘Bluetooth’ button for about ten (10) seconds until you hear a tone. This will help the Bose speaker to clear all Bluetooth devices that have been paired with it.

How do I connect my Bose headphones to my phone?
Slide the power switch toward the Bluetooth symbol, and hold it there until you hear a voice prompt letting you know the headphones are ready to pair. The Bluetooth indicator will also blink in blue. Open your smartphone’s Bluetooth menu and allow it to discover new devices. Select the “Bose QuietComfort 35 II” from the list.
